Tributes Paid to Atal Bihari Vajpayee on His Death Anniversary

On the anniversary of Atal Bihari Vajpayee's passing, dignitaries including Prime Minister Narendra Modi and former hockey captain Sardar Singh gathered to pay their respects at 'Sadaiv Atal' in New Delhi. Vajpayee, a pivotal figure in Indian politics and a celebrated poet, served as Prime Minister for three terms and was awarded the Bharat Ratna in 2015. Dignitaries Honor Vajpayee's Memory

On Sunday, former Indian men's hockey captain Sardar Singh honored the late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ee during a prayer meeting held at 'Sadaiv Atal' in New Delhi, marking his death anniversary.


In an interview, Sardar Singh expressed his pride in attending the event, noting the presence of numerous esteemed leaders. He remarked, "It was a wonderful experience. Today, we paid our respects to Atal Bihari Vajpayee, and the love shown for him was truly uplifting."


Earlier in the day, Prime Minister Narendra Modi laid floral tributes at the memorial 'Sadaiv Atal' in honor of Vajpayee. The ceremony was attended by President Droupadi Murmu, Vice President CP Radhakrishnan, BJP National President Nitin Nabin, and other senior officials.


Commemorating a Political Icon

Atal Bihari Vajpayee, a distinguished figure in Indian politics, served as Prime Minister across three terms. His initial term began briefly in 1996, followed by two consecutive terms from 1998 to 2004.


Renowned for his eloquence and statesmanship, Vajpayee was a founding member of the Bharatiya Janata Party and significantly influenced its political trajectory. His leadership saw India advance in various sectors, including infrastructure, diplomacy, economic reforms, and national security.


In addition to his political achievements, Vajpayee was a celebrated Hindi poet, earning respect from all political factions for his contributions to public life. He was awarded the Bharat Ratna, India's highest civilian honor, in 2015 for his service to the nation.


Vajpayee passed away on August 16, 2018, at the age of 93. His death anniversary serves as a time to reflect on his life, contributions, and enduring legacy.
